Two-tailed Hypothesis
A statistical test hypothesis that considers both directions of effect, allowing for testing differences in either direction.
Degrees of Freedom
The count of individual values or magnitudes that may be allocated to a statistical distribution without breaking any limitations.
Sample Size
The number of observations or individuals taken from a population to form a sample for the purpose of statistical analysis.
Variance Accounted
A measure of the proportion of the total variance in a dataset that is explained or accounted for by a statistical model or factor.
